Izak Burger wrote: > I suspect we're simply dealing with a process that creates a LOT of > savepoints before finally committing. The developer of the application > is out at the moment, when he gets back from his lunch-break/touch-rugby > game I shall ask him about this.
The developer confirmed that the process imports a lot of data, and commits every now and then. By comitting more often we can keep these files smaller. I've been watching it for a while now, and I see it grows to about 7.3 GB and then it starts over again. It seems everything works as it should then, the important thing is simply to have enough space on /tmp.
